At the core of sustainable building practices lies energy efficiency. Designing buildings to devour minimal energy can considerably reduce carbon emissions over their lifetime. This might contain incorporating high-quality insulation, energy-efficient windows, and appliances, as nicely as using renewable energy sources similar to solar or wind energy. By decreasing reliance on non-renewable energy, a building can contribute positively to the environment.
Water conservation additionally plays an essential function in sustainable construction. The integration of rainwater harvesting, greywater recycling methods, and water-efficient fixtures can markedly decrease water utilization in buildings. Employing drought-resistant landscaping can further decrease water waste. These approaches not only protect the valuable resource of water but additionally contribute to decreasing utility costs for occupants.
Selecting sustainable materials is another fundamental aspect of accountable building practices. Traditional building materials typically have a major environmental footprint. By choosing domestically sourced, reclaimed, or quickly renewable materials, buildings can scale back their impact on the ecosystem. This shift may help support local economies and cut back transportation emissions, making a more sustainable cycle of useful resource usage.

Indoor air quality deserves consideration as properly. Buildings must be designed to boost air circulation and use non-toxic, low-VOC materials and finishes. This method helps guarantee a healthy indoor setting for occupants, reducing health risks associated with pollutants. Sustainable building practices, subsequently, not only handle environmental considerations but also prioritize human health and comfort.
The position of technology in sustainable building can't be understated. Innovations in construction applied sciences, corresponding to building info modeling (BIM) and energy modeling software, facilitate more exact and environment friendly designs. These tools allow architects and builders to create energy-efficient constructions whereas minimizing resource waste in the course of the construction part. As technology continues to advance, the potential to additional hone building practices increases dramatically.

Collaboration amongst stakeholders is important to advancing sustainable building practices. Architects, builders, developers, and policymakers should work together to create and implement guidelines that encourage sustainable growth. Establishing clear incentives for adopting green building practices can stimulate investment in more sustainable initiatives, resulting in broader environmental benefits.
Government rules play a big function in shaping the development landscape. Policies that promote sustainability, corresponding to tax credits for energy-efficient buildings or stricter building codes concerning energy consumption, can drive change. By establishing clear requirements and benchmarks, governments can encourage the industry to prioritize sustainable building practices in design and construction.

What are sustainable building practices?
Sustainable building practices contain design, construction, and operation strategies geared toward reducing negative environmental impacts while promoting resource effectivity. This consists of utilizing eco-friendly materials, energy-efficient methods, and sustainable land use.

What materials are generally utilized in sustainable building?
Common materials in sustainable building include reclaimed wooden, bamboo, recycled metallic, and low-VOC (volatile organic compounds) paints. These materials not only reduce environmental impression but usually improve indoor air quality.
How do sustainable buildings save energy?
Sustainable buildings save energy by way of the use of energy-efficient appliances, correct insulation, and sustainable designs that maximize pure mild and air flow. This reduces reliance on non-renewable energy sources and lowers utility payments.

What certifications exist for sustainable buildings?
Various certifications exist, similar to LEED (Leadership in Energy and Environmental Design), BREEAM (Building Research Establishment Environmental Assessment Method), and the Living Building Challenge. These certifications help validate sustainable practices and may improve property worth.

What function does landscaping play in sustainable building?
Landscaping contributes considerably to sustainability by selling biodiversity, managing water runoff, and utilizing native crops that require much less upkeep and irrigation. Thoughtful landscaping can improve the ecosystem and scale back the environmental impression of buildings.
Are there tax incentives for building sustainably?
Many areas supply tax incentives, rebates, or grants for sustainable building practices. These incentives differ by location and should embrace deductions for energy-efficient upgrades or credit for using renewable assets in construction.
